Buying or selling property in Tanzania could soon become more transparent. The government is planning a dedicated real estate regulator to improve standards, accountability, and investor confidence.

Tanzania is moving to establish a dedicated real estate regulatory agency aimed at improving transparency and professionalism across the property sector. The proposed body is expected to oversee industry standards, strengthen consumer protection, and address longstanding concerns around unregulated transactions and unethical practices. Better regulation could increase confidence among homebuyers, developers, and investors while creating a more predictable market environment. The initiative also reflects growing recognition of real estate as an important driver of economic development. If implemented, the reforms could pave the way for a more organized and investment-friendly property market.
